2015 International Conference on Antenna Theory and Techniques (ICATT), 2015
Advantages of the diamond dipole antenna as an active antenna are presented. Such an antenna is like an inverted bow-tie antenna, but the former has some advantages over the ordinary bow-tie antenna. It is shown that the diamond dipole antenna may be an effective element of a new antenna array for low-frequency radio astronomy as well as a ...

As electromagnetic energy passes through a planar array of linear dipoles, it undergoes a phase shift which is a function of the operating frequency and the array parameters. This property has been used to design and construct a lightweight zoned microwave lens antenna which has possible spacecraft applications.

Modeling Earth as a Dipole Antenna
2020 IEEE Green Technologies Conference(GreenTech), 2020The Earth has been represented as a simple dipole antenna to better understand how the electromagnetic field(s) envelopes the Earth and radiates into space. There are three electromagnetic patterns that emerge in my model, which correspond to the far radiative field, the near inductive field and a newly defined magnetoquasistatic field.
